9.5.3.2) Target pressure reduction at excessive airbox temperature
See Pic. 31.
During compression process in the turbo charger the intake air will be heated.
To reduce the risk of knocking combustion at high boost pressure with high
intake air temperature, lowering of the target pressure will start at 72°C
(162°F) airbox temperature. See diagram, Pic. 31.

Boost pressure reduction will result in a drop of performance e.g. the power
drop can reach up to 10 kW at 80°C airbox temperature.
â—† NOTE: On TCU part no. 966.741 the target pressure reduction
starts at 88° C. See Pic. 31/1.
